Generador gratuït de UUID en línia
Genera UUID v4 segur i aleatori (RFC 4122) en línia, a l'instant.
Genera identificadors UUID v4 a l'instant, totalment conformes amb RFC 4122, utilitzant generació aleatòria criptogràficament segura. Ideal per crear IDs anònims, únics i resistents a col·lisions per a desenvolupament web, APIs, sistemes distribuïts, dispositius IoT i microserveis, tot directament des del teu navegador.
Generador massiu de UUID
Eina de Validació UUID
Què és un UUID v4?
UUID versió 4 (UUID v4) és un identificador universal únic de 128 bits definit per la norma RFC 4122. Generat purament a partir de números aleatoris, UUID v4 permet als desenvolupadors assignar identificadors únics sense necessitat d'una autoritat central. És ideal per a APIs, bases de dades, aplicacions web i entorns distribuïts on la unicitat i la senzillesa són claus.
Estructura i Format de l'UUID v4
- Longitud en bits: 128 bits (16 bytes)
- Estructura: 8-4-4-4-12 caràcters hexadecimals, separats per guions
- Exemple d'UUID: f47ac10b-58cc-4372-a567-0e02b2c3d479
- Longitud total: 36 caràcters (incloent guions)
- Número de versió: El tercer segment sempre comença amb un 4 per indicar la versió v4
- Bits de variant: El quart segment defineix els bits de variant segons els estàndards UUID
Desglossament d'un UUID v4 d'exemple
Analitzem aquest UUID v4 d'exemple: f47ac10b-58cc-4372-a567-0e02b2c3d479
- f47ac10b – Bits aleatoris (segment time_low)
- 58cc – Bits aleatoris (segment time_mid)
- 4372 – Bits aleatoris amb el primer 4 indicant la versió 4
- a567 – Bits de seqüència i variant
- 0e02b2c3d479 – Informació aleatòria del node
Principals motius per utilitzar UUID v4
- Extremadament segur, generat aleatòriament i altament resistent a col·lisions
- No es requereix cap servidor central ni coordinació per a identificadors únics
- Complertament compatible amb RFC 4122 per a fiabilitat i estàndards
- Suportat en llenguatges populars com JavaScript, Python, Go, Rust, Node.js, Java i més
- Ideal per a APIs, sessions d'usuari, identificadors de fitxers, sistemes IoT i microserveis distribuïts
Usos comuns del UUID v4
- Generació de tokens de sessió segurs per a sistemes d'autenticació
- Assignació d'ID únics a recursos, fitxers o usuaris
- Creació de claus primàries de base de dades que eviten duplicats i condicions de competència
- Etiquetatge i identificació de dades o sensors de dispositius IoT
- Desenvolupament d'aplicacions escalables i distribuïdes que requereixen identificadors únics
Privadesa i Seguretat de UUID v4
UUID v4 mai emmagatzema segells de temps, identificadors de dispositius, adreces MAC ni dades personals d'usuaris. El seu disseny aleatori ajuda a mantenir la seguretat i la privadesa. Quan es genera correctament, els 122 bits aleatoris són criptogràficament segurs.